Club heads to Klagenfurt for clash with Sturm Graz

Blauw-Zwart's 21-member selection is boarding a plane for Austria this morning. We take off at 11 a.m. in Ostend to land in Klagenfurt about 2 hours later.

Tomorrow evening the second game in the League Phase of the Champions League is scheduled. In Klagenfurt we will take on Sturm Graz, which lost its first game to Stade Brest 2-1.

A light training program will follow today. After arriving in Klagenfurt, the staff and players first settle in the hotel and play off the plane legs. A press conference with coach Hayen and Christos Tzolis for the local and Belgian press will follow at 5:45 p.m. in the Wörthersee Stadium. Afterwards, the group will train one last time before the match at 6:30 p.m. in the stadium.

The next morning on matchday the group will first walk the legs around 10:30 am. After lunch there will be several team meetings leading up to the match. At 9 p.m. the match against Sturm Graz gets underway, to be followed live on VTM2 and via live updates in the Club app.
